Biography
Anthony G. Cain provided the following biographical information via Ballotpedia's Candidate Connection survey on March 28, 2026:
- High school: Delcastle Technical High School
- Bachelor's: Delaware State University, 1996
- Graduate: Wilmington University, 2012
- Military service: United States Navy, 1988-2022
- Profession: Teacher
- Incumbent officeholder: No
Elections
General election
The general election will occur on May 12, 2026.
General election for Caesar Rodney School District, At-large (2 seats)
Anthony G. Cain (Nonpartisan), Andrea E. Ekwem (Nonpartisan), Dave Failing (Nonpartisan), and Michael A. Marasco (Nonpartisan) are running in the general election for Caesar Rodney School District, At-large on May 12, 2026.

Anthony G. Cain completed Ballotpedia's Candidate Connection survey in 2026. The survey questions appear in bold and are followed by Cain's responses.
| Collapse all
- I want to strengthen student achievement in math and literacy by supporting effective instruction and targeted interventions.
- I also hope to successfully negotiate a fair and sustainable CREA contract that supports both educators and the district.
- Recruiting and retaining high-quality teachers and staff will be a major priority, along with ensuring schools remain safe, welcoming, and positive learning environments where all students can succeed.
